Long Term Care Ombudsman

May 2026

Exempt


As an employee of Trident Area Agency on Aging, the Long-Term Care Ombudsman will provide investigation and resolution of complaints on behalf of residents of long-term care facilities, Office of Mental Health and Office of Intellectual and Developmental Disabilities facilities; advocacy and mediation; community education and training; and on-site visits to facilities.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ES:

• Participate in timely receipt, investigation and resolution of complaints on behalf of residents of long-term care facilities, Office of Mental Health and Office of Intellectual Developmental Disabilities facilities

• Prepares intake from concerns and collects relevant information in response to calls, walk-ins or written requests

• Maintains records and completes required reports while maintaining the confidentiality of client information

• Perform duties in accordance with state ombudsman regulations and requirements

• Promotes public understanding of residents’ rights and other long-term care matters, through the development and distribution of materials, public speaking, and training activities

• Coordinates the ombudsman activities and collaborates with agencies that regulate and license long term care facilities

• Develop reports, background materials, and other documentation needed on advocacy issues

• Provides training and consultation to residents, families, residents’ councils, and staff of long-term care facilities

• Promotes community and volunteer support for residents of long-term care facilities

• Performs all other duties as assigned by the Regional Long Term Care Ombudsman

• Attends training sessions as offered to maintain certification

• Attends and participates in scheduled state office and staff meetings


REQUIRED K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:

• Ability to establish and maintain an effective relationship with the State Unit on Aging, provider agencies, community-based organizations, long-term care facilities and staff

• 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ing

• Must be able to operate a personal computer and be proficient with word processing programs, databases, spreadsheets, and internet use

• According to federal regulations, must be certified by the State Long Term Care Ombudsman within one year of hire and be free of conflicts of interest

• Ability to interview effectively in a manner to elicit relevant information

• Good organizational, planning, and coordination skills

• Knowledge of the practices, techniques, and standard equipment used for filing, record keeping, and general office procedures

• Maintain the confidentiality of clients’ records

• Ability to always represent the agency in a professional manner

• A valid SC Drivers License and good driving record

• Dependable transportation for on-site visits to long-term care facilities, hospitals, police departments, etc.


MINIMUM E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E: A Bachelor’s Degree in Social Work, Nursing, or related field with two or more years’ experience in long term care.


SUPERVISORY RELATIONSHIP: Will report to the Regional Long Term Care Ombudsman of Trident Area Agency on Aging. In addition, technical assistance is available through the State Long Term Care Ombudsman.


WORK HOURS: Full-time employment with typical hours of 8:30 AM until 5:00 PM, Monday through Friday. Hours may need to be flexible at times to participate in after-hours work-related activities.
